Polysense Technologies, a provider of low-power wide-area (LPWA) Internet of Things (IoT) solutions for wireless sensing, has introduced its latest suite of indoor air quality (IAQ) sensors, representing the next generation of the company’s PSS sensors product line. These ready-to-use multi-sensor solutions are powered by the iEdge 4.0 operating system (OS) and the adaptable WxS product platform, designed to offer a seamless and modular approach to IAQ monitoring.

The expanded PSS IAQ sensor portfolio introduces ten sophisticated models, adding to Polysense’s extensive catalogue of over 300 gas sensors and multi-analyte sensors. These sensors are crafted to offer immediate, out-of-the-box solutions for a variety of environments, including commercial, educational, industrial and public spaces worldwide.

Each PSS IAQ sensor is engineered with advanced detection capabilities to identify and quantify indoor pollutants and contaminants such as CO2, total volatile organic compounds (TVOCs), HCHO and particulate matter (PM) levels. These ready-to-use sensors also monitor temperature, humidity and air pressure, providing a full spectrum analysis of indoor environments to facilitate swift and informed decisions for air quality improvement.

A key feature of the new PSS IAQ sensors is their seamless integration with WxS terminals, such as the WxS8800 for LoRaWAN, WxS9900 for narrowband Internet of Things (NB-IoT) and WxSD800 for long-term evolution technology for machines (LTE Cat M). 

These terminals provide a flexible wireless uplink for cloud connectivity, supporting a range of protocols including NB-IoT, Wi-Fi, LoRaWAN and LTE Cat 1, Cat M and Cat 4. This ensures that the PSS IAQ sensors can be easily integrated into existing smart systems and IoT ecosystems, enabling remote monitoring and data analysis.

Polysense’s build-your-own-devices (BYOD) philosophy enables customers to mix and match PSS sensors to create custom solutions that target specific gas parameters. The new PSS multiple-in-one sensors are pre-integrated, tested and ready for immediate use, offering ease of deployment and reliability.
